Slippy shoes
I bought a pair of De Hav's in the sale at TS a couple of weeks ago. They are not unlike the platform's that Small Girl has in her signature pic. They have a peep toe and a wedge and are very high. I am dying to wear them, but they slip dreadfully and to such an extent that when my foot slips out I have to hobble and stumble a bit to get it back in the shoe as they are quite high backed. They are the right size and not too big - any smaller and they would hurt. I have inserted a pair of the Dr. School party feet things but they don't seem to work. They are completely unwearable at the mo. Does any one have any ideas about how to stop them slipping. Thanks
Answer:
I had exactly the same problem with a pair of high peep toes and found the party feet not to work!! I instead bought some Scholl foot cushions which fit under the ball of your foot and just under your toes which stop your foot from falling forwards and keeps the shoe more secure. I got them from Boots and don't scrunch up like the gel ones :)
